diff --git a/kiss/mkiss.8 b/kiss/mkiss.8 new file mode 100644 index 0000000..4c6c973 --- /dev/null +++ b/kiss/mkiss.8 @@ -0,0 +1,66 @@ +.TH MKISS 8 "05 January 1997" Linux "Linux System Managers Manual" +.SH NAME +mkiss \- Attach a multi KISS interface +.SH SYNOPSIS +.B mkiss [-c] [-h] [-l] [-s speed] [-p] [-v] ttyinterface pty... +.SH DESCRIPTION +.LP +.B Mkiss +allows dual port TNCs or multiple TNCs sharing the same serial port to be +used with the Linux AX.25 kernel software. The AX.25 softare has no support +for dual port TNCs or multiple TNCs charing the same serial line. The +different ports are addressed by encoding the port number in the control +byte of every kiss frame. +.B Mkiss +watches a serial port, and routes kiss frames to/from the pseudo ttys. The +other side of the pseudo ttys are then attached with +.B kissattach +as normal. +.sp 1 +Statistics about the operation of +.B mkiss +may be obtained by sending the SIGUSR1 signal to the running program. On +reception of such a signal +.B mkiss +will print a set of statistics to the system log if logging has been +enabled. +.sp 1 +Although mention is made of using pseudo ttys as the last arguments, +these devices may be normal serial ports. However +.B mkiss +provides no way in which to set their speed, the speed must therefore be set +by some other method. +.SH OPTIONS +.TP 10 +.BI \-c +This enables a one-byte checksum on each incoming and outgoing KISS frame on +the serial port. This checksum is used by G8BPQ KISS roms to maintain the +integrity of KISS frames. +.TP 10 +.BI \-h +Enables hardware handshaking on the serial line to the TNC. The KISS +specification states that no hardware flow control shall be used so the +default is off. But some KISS implementations do use hardware flow control. +.TP 10 +.BI \-l +Enables system logging, the default is off. +.TP 10 +.BI "\-s speed" +Set the speed of the serial port. +.TP 10 +.BI "\-p" +Enables polling. Polled mode is used by G8BPQ KISS roms to prevent +contention on systems where multiple TNCs share the same serial line. +.TP 10 +.BI \-v +Display the version. +.SH "SEE ALSO" +.BR kissattach (8), +.BR ifconfig (8), +.BR kill (1). +.SH AUTHORS +Tomi Manninen OH2BNS <tpmannin@cc.hut.fi> +.br +Jonathan Naylor G4KLX <g4klx@g4klx.demon.co.uk> +.br +Kevin Uhlir N0BEL <kevinu@flochart.com> |
